HideCaret 함수(winuser.h)

화면에서 캐리트를 제거합니다. 캐리트를 숨기면 현재 도형이 삭제되거나 삽입 지점이 무효화되지 않습니다.

구문

BOOL HideCaret(
  [in, optional] HWND hWnd
);

매개 변수

[in, optional] hWnd

형식: HWND

캐리트를 소유하는 창에 대한 핸들입니다. 이 매개 변수가 NULL인 경우 HideCaret 는 현재 작업에서 캐리트를 소유하는 창을 검색합니다.

반환 값

형식: BOOL

함수가 성공하면 반환 값이 0이 아닙니다.

함수가 실패하면 반환 값은 0입니다. 확장 오류 정보를 가져오려면 GetLastError를 호출합니다.

설명

HideCaret 는 지정된 창이 캐리트를 소유하는 경우에만 캐리트를 숨깁니다. 지정된 창에 캐리트가 없으면 HideCaret 는 아무 것도 수행하지 않고 FALSE를 반환합니다.

숨기기는 누적됩니다. 애플리케이션이 HideCaret를 5번 연속으로 호출하는 경우, 또한 Caret가 표시되기 전에 ShowCaret 를 다섯 번 호출해야 합니다.

예제는 Caret 숨기기를 참조하세요.

요구 사항

   
지원되는 최소 클라이언트 Windows 2000 Professional[데스크톱 앱만]
지원되는 최소 서버 Windows 2000 Server[데스크톱 앱만]
대상 플랫폼 Windows
헤더 winuser.h(Windows.h 포함)
라이브러리 User32.lib
DLL User32.dll
API 세트 ext-ms-win-ntuser-caret-l1-1-0(Windows 8에서 도입)

추가 정보

캐럿

개념

CreateCaret

DestroyCaret

GetCaretPos

참조

SetCaretPos

ShowCaret